On Wed, 7 Mar 2007 11:45:12 +0100, "Kasper Katzmann"
<nogen@microsoft.com> wrote:
>Kan man det her? Og i så fald hvordan skal man gøre uden at få en fejl? Det
>lader til at det er selve concateneringen der fejler.
>
><%
>
>'r51 er et tal mellem 1 og 5 eller tom
>'I det her tilfælde er r51 = 3
>r51 = Request.Form("r51")
>
>prio1 = "n/a"
>prio2 = "n/a"
>prio3 = "n/a"
>prio4 = "n/a"
>prio5 = "n/a"
>
>for i = 1 to 5
> if cInt(r51) = i then
> prio+i = "R51"
> end if
>next
If cInt(r51) = i then
strAssign = "prio" & i & " = ""R51"""
Execute(strAssign)
' Eller bare:
' Execute("prio" & i & " = ""R51""")
End if
>Efter min bedste overbevisning burde det give:
>n/a
>n/a
>R51
>n/a
>n/a
Jeps.
Good luck,
Jørn
--
Jørn Andersen, Brønshøj
ALLE danske tropper HJEM fra Irak, NU
Skriv under:
www.kirkmand-initiativet.dk
Demonstrér 17. marts:
www.nejtilkrig.dk